What are acceptable sources? All fields in science have peer reviewed publications, usually in the form of journals. This is how research and are presented. Peer reviewed means they have gone through a rigorous process and any conclusions presented have to include what methods were used as well as background and analysis. The supplemental readings I have provided in class have all been from such sources. Here are a few examples in the Anthropology world: And will give you possible links to all anthropology journals. You are more than welcome to bring in publications from other disciplines. In-text citation: This is a concept that eludes most people. If you are using an idea that is not common knowledge you need to provide a in-text citation (see style guide and assignment). When you are paraphrasing one of your sources, you need to cite. When you quote, you need to cite. When in doubt, cite. Not citing is called plagiarism.
